Michaels Connecticut Store Locator

Address, Contact Information, & Hours of Operation for Michaels Locations in Connecticut

Locations:
  1. Avon
  2. Brookfield
  3. Dayville
  4. Enfield
  5. Lisbon
  6. Manchester
  7. Meriden
  8. Milford
  9. New Britain
  10. Newington
  11. North Haven
  12. Stamford
  13. Waterbury
  14. Waterford